The 'My Friends Are Yours' Brand Profile: A Vision of Shared Longevity
The core ethos of "My Friends Are Yours" is built on the concept of shared value—not just in a social sense, but in the tangible quality and longevity of its garments. The brand is a direct response to the environmental and ethical crises perpetuated by the global fast fashion industry, positioning itself as a leader in the conscious consumption movement.
The founder, known simply as Ella, has centered her entire business model on principles that are often overlooked by larger corporations, leading to a unique and highly desirable product. Her vision is to create clothing that is designed to be re-worn, restyled, and made to last, fostering a deeper, more meaningful relationship between the wearer and their wardrobe.
- Founder: Ella (Founder of My Friends Are Yours)
- Launch Date: May 2021
- Headquarters: Sydney, Australia
- Core Mission: To create a small, slow fashion label focused on longevity, ethical production, and local manufacturing.
- Key Success Metric: Initial collections sold out within minutes, highlighting significant consumer demand for their ethical model.
- Production Model: 100% locally designed and manufactured in Australia.
- Philosophy: Quality over quantity; garments designed for re-wear and restyling.
- Cultural Context: The phrase itself is a statement on hospitality and shared community, which the brand translates into a shared responsibility for sustainable practices.
The label’s success is a clear indicator that consumers are willing to invest more in garments that align with their values. By focusing on quality and a limited, locally-produced supply, "My Friends Are Yours" creates a scarcity that is driven by ethical practice, not artificial marketing.
Why Local Manufacturing is the Ultimate Luxury in 2025
In a world dominated by complex, opaque global supply chains, the commitment of "My Friends Are Yours" to 100% local manufacturing in Sydney is arguably its most radical and valuable feature. This decision directly addresses several key pain points in the modern fashion industry: ethical labor, carbon footprint, and quality control.
Local production ensures complete transparency and adherence to Australian labor laws, eliminating the risk of unethical labor practices commonly associated with offshore manufacturing. Furthermore, it drastically reduces the brand's carbon footprint by minimizing long-distance shipping of raw materials and finished goods. This hyperlocal model is becoming a significant trend in 2025, as consumers increasingly prioritize a brand's environmental, social, and governance (ESG) performance.
The local focus allows founder Ella to maintain an intimate relationship with the production process, ensuring the highest standards of craftsmanship and material quality. This level of control is essential for creating the durable, high-quality pieces that define the slow fashion movement. The Cultural Resonance: From Classic Literature to Circularity
The phrase "My Friends Are Yours" carries a profound cultural weight that the fashion label cleverly leverages. Its origin as a statement of hospitality, trust, and shared community is evident in various historical and cultural contexts, which adds a layer of intellectual depth to the brand's simple aesthetic.
One of the earliest appearances of the sentiment is found in Thomas Hardy's The Woodlanders, where it signifies a deep commitment to shared resources and loyalty. This classic literary reference imbues the phrase with a sense of enduring value and tradition. Similarly, the line appears in the theme song of My Little Pony: Friendship Is Magic, reinforcing a message of inclusivity and shared joy.
The fashion brand translates this cultural history into a modern principle of Circular Fashion. If your friends are yours, then the resources used to create your clothing—the fabric, the labor, the design—are also part of a shared, valued ecosystem. This philosophical underpinning encourages customers to engage in responsible consumption, garment care, and eventually, upcycling or resale. The brand implicitly asks the consumer to view their clothing not as a personal possession to be discarded, but as a shared resource with a long life cycle.
